#6f19cc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6f19cc is composed of 43.5% red, 9.8%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.6% cyan, 87.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 268.8 degrees, a saturation of 78.2% and a lightness of 44.9%. #6f19cc color hex could be obtained by blending #de32ff with #000099.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#6f19cc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#6f19cc has RGB values of R:111, G:25,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 7281100.

Hex triplet 6f19cc #6f19cc
RGB Decimal 111, 25, 204 rgb(111,25,204)
RGB Percent 43.5, 9.8, 80 rgb(43.5%,9.8%,80%)
CMYK 46, 88, 0, 20
HSL 268.8°, 78.2, 44.9 hsl(268.8,78.2%,44.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 268.8°, 87.7, 80
Web Safe 6600cc #6600cc
CIE-LAB 34.872, 66.793, -74.242
XYZ 17.8, 8.434, 57.814
xyY 0.212, 0.1, 8.434
CIE-LCH 34.872, 99.866, 311.976
CIE-LUV 34.872, 11.894, -104.015
Hunter-Lab 29.042, 58.583, -97.699
Binary 01101111, 00011001, 11001100

Shades and Tints of #6f19cc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06010c is the darkest color, while #fcf9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6f19cc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#727174 is the less saturated color, while #6e07de is the most saturated one.
